西门子编程软件用什么好
-
如果你正在寻找一个优秀的编程软件来使用西门子设备,那么西门子自家的编程软件STEP 7可能是一个不错的选择。
STEP 7是西门子公司为其自家设备开发的集成开发环境(IDE),用于编程和配置PLC(可编程逻辑控制器)和HMI(人机界面)等设备。它提供了一系列强大的工具和功能,使得编程和配置西门子设备变得更加简单和高效。
首先,STEP 7具有直观的用户界面,易于上手和操作。它提供了丰富的功能模块和库,使得编程过程更加灵活和方便。无论你是初学者还是有经验的程序员,都可以轻松上手并快速掌握。
其次,STEP 7具有强大的调试和故障排除功能。它提供了实时监控和仿真功能,可以帮助你在编程过程中发现和解决潜在的问题。此外,它还支持在线调试和远程访问,使得故障排除更加便捷和高效。
另外,STEP 7还具有丰富的网络功能和通信协议支持。它可以与其他设备和系统进行无缝集成,实现数据的交互和共享。无论是与其他PLC设备、SCADA系统还是上层管理系统,STEP 7都能够提供稳定可靠的通信连接。
总之,如果你正在寻找一个优秀的编程软件来使用西门子设备,STEP 7可能是一个不错的选择。它具有直观的用户界面、强大的功能和灵活的编程模块,可以帮助你更加高效地编程和配置西门子设备。同时,它还具有强大的调试和故障排除功能,以及丰富的网络和通信支持。无论你是初学者还是有经验的程序员,STEP 7都能够满足你的需求。
1年前 -
西门子编程软件是指西门子公司开发的用于编程和控制西门子自动化设备的软件工具。西门子公司是全球知名的工业自动化和数字化解决方案提供商,在工业领域具有广泛的应用和市场份额。西门子编程软件主要包括以下几个方面的工具和平台。
-
TIA Portal(全名:Totally Integrated Automation Portal):TIA Portal是西门子公司最新推出的集成工程平台,用于编程和配置西门子自动化设备。TIA Portal提供了一套完整的工具,包括PLC编程、HMI设计、驱动器配置等。它具有直观的界面和强大的功能,可以提高工程师的工作效率和开发速度。
-
STEP 7(全名:SIMATIC Engineering Program 7):STEP 7是西门子公司经典的PLC编程软件,用于编程和调试西门子的SIMATIC系列PLC。STEP 7提供了多种编程语言,如Ladder Diagram(梯形图)、Structured Text(结构化文本)等,适用于不同的编程需求。它还具有强大的在线调试功能,方便工程师进行实时监测和故障排除。
-
WinCC(全名:Windows Control Center):WinCC是西门子公司的人机界面(HMI)设计软件,用于创建和配置操作界面。WinCC提供了丰富的图形库和功能模块,可以实现直观的操作界面和数据可视化。它还支持与PLC的数据通信,实现实时数据的监测和控制。
-
SINAMICS Startdrive:SINAMICS Startdrive是西门子公司的驱动器配置和调试软件,用于配置和调试西门子的SINAMICS系列驱动器。Startdrive提供了直观的界面和丰富的配置选项,方便工程师对驱动器进行参数设置和故障诊断。
-
S7-PLCSIM:S7-PLCSIM是西门子公司提供的虚拟PLC仿真软件,用于在计算机上模拟运行PLC程序。工程师可以使用S7-PLCSIM进行PLC程序的开发和调试,而无需实际的硬件设备。这大大提高了开发效率和节省了成本。
总结来说,西门子编程软件包括TIA Portal、STEP 7、WinCC、SINAMICS Startdrive和S7-PLCSIM等工具,它们提供了全面的编程和配置功能,方便工程师进行西门子自动化设备的开发和调试工作。具体选择哪个软件取决于具体的应用需求和个人偏好。
1年前 -
-
西门子编程软件主要用于西门子PLC(可编程逻辑控制器)的编程和调试。目前,西门子公司推出了几个不同版本的编程软件,包括STEP 7(TIA Portal)和STEP 7 Micro/WIN。下面将对这两个软件进行介绍。
- STEP 7 (TIA Portal):
STEP 7是西门子公司最新的编程软件,也是最为广泛使用的。它提供了全面的PLC编程功能,适用于西门子的S7-300、S7-400、S7-1200和S7-1500系列PLC。TIA Portal是STEP 7的集成开发环境,除了PLC编程外,还提供了HMI(人机界面)开发和其他功能。
使用STEP 7 (TIA Portal)进行PLC编程的步骤如下:
-
创建一个新的项目,并选择适当的PLC型号。
-
在项目中添加PLC硬件配置,包括CPU、输入输出模块和通信模块等。
-
配置PLC硬件参数,如IP地址、通信协议等。
-
创建PLC程序,可以使用Ladder Diagram(梯形图)、Function Block Diagram(功能块图)或Structured Text(结构化文本)等编程语言。
-
编写PLC程序逻辑,并进行调试和测试。
-
下载程序到PLC,并进行实际运行。
-
STEP 7 Micro/WIN:
STEP 7 Micro/WIN是一款专门为西门子S7-200系列PLC设计的编程软件。相对于STEP 7 (TIA Portal),它的功能更简单、界面更直观,适用于较小规模的PLC应用。
使用STEP 7 Micro/WIN进行PLC编程的步骤如下:
- 创建一个新的项目,并选择S7-200型号。
- 配置PLC硬件参数,如IP地址、通信协议等。
- 创建PLC程序,可以使用Ladder Diagram(梯形图)或Instruction List(指令列表)等编程语言。
- 编写PLC程序逻辑,并进行调试和测试。
- 下载程序到PLC,并进行实际运行。
总的来说,如果需要开发较大规模的PLC应用,建议使用STEP 7 (TIA Portal)进行编程。如果只是进行简单的PLC应用开发,可以选择STEP 7 Micro/WIN。不过,具体选择哪个软件还要根据实际需求和PLC型号来决定。
1年前 - STEP 7 (TIA Portal):